How they compare

Western Europe currently reports 46.90 million 1000 USD against 17.71 million 1000 USD in China (People’s Republic of), a difference of 29.19 million 1000 USD.

That makes Western Europe's figure about 2.6 times China (People’s Republic of)'s.

Across all 64 years both countries report, Western Europe has been ahead every year.

China (People’s Republic of) ranks 3rd and Western Europe ranks 5th of 219 countries.

Western Europe has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ade China (People’s Republic of) Western Europe Difference Ahead
1960s 65,535 1000 USD 796,956 1000 USD 731,421 1000 USD Western Europe
1970s 326,123 1000 USD 3.74 million 1000 USD 3.41 million 1000 USD Western Europe
1980s 781,003 1000 USD 10.11 million 1000 USD 9.33 million 1000 USD Western Europe
1990s 2.59 million 1000 USD 23.00 million 1000 USD 20.41 million 1000 USD Western Europe
2000s 6.07 million 1000 USD 39.91 million 1000 USD 33.83 million 1000 USD Western Europe
2010s 14.21 million 1000 USD 45.89 million 1000 USD 31.68 million 1000 USD Western Europe
2020s 16.55 million 1000 USD 48.97 million 1000 USD 32.43 million 1000 USD Western Europe

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
